Rosemary Reznikoff Cornell was born on April 24, 1935 in New York City and passed away peacefully on April 26, 2018. She was the daughter of Dr. Paul and Dorothy Reznikoff. Rosemary grew up in two residences. During the school year the family lived in Pelham, NY where Rosemary attended the Pelham public schools (including Pelham Memorial High School). She excelled in academics and sports. Her interests included modern dance and cheer leading. She was a very close friend and supporter to her sister Camilla (now deceased) and two younger brothers, Paul (now deceased) and William Reznikoff of Woods Hole MA, although she sometimes bested them in neighborhood stickball games. The family spent the summers in Woods Hole, MA where Rosemary spent her time sailing, attending and teaching at the Woods Hole Science School and singing in the Church of the Messiah.
Rosemary graduated with distinction from Mount Holyoke College where she majored in chemistry. In addition to raising a family, Rosemary had a very successful career as a Chemist and an analytical instrument representative for Hewlett Packard. Rosemary was passionate about singing in the church choir and was an active volunteer in retirement at a local Audubon society and as a mentor for local grade school children.
